From the Codex:
In other words, the author template is used to show posts made by one person as well as their bio (if so configured). Whether or not to use it is up you, so go ahead and remove it if you want or if you are the only author. |

Author.php is part of the Archive.php hierarchy. It goes:
Single.php is what it's name suggests and is related to posts, custom posts and attachments.
